Avocado Chocolate Cookies

Deliciously indulgent cookies made with avocado for a healthy twist on a classic treat.

Ingredients

  • 1 ripe avocado, mashed
  • 1/2 cup cocoa powder
  • 1/2 cup almond flour
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1/4 cup coconut s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 cup dark chocolate chips (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Prepare the avocado by cutting it in half, removing the pit, and mashing it until smooth.
  3. Combine the wet ingredients: honey (or maple syrup), coconut sugar, and vanilla extract, into the mashed avocado and stir until well combined.
  4. Mix the dry ingredients in a separate bowl: almond fl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t.
  5. Combine the dry ingredients with the avocado mixture, stirring gently until just mixed. Add dark chocolate chips if desired.
  6. Scoop spoonfuls of dough onto a lined baking sheet, spacing them 2 inches apart.
  7.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are firm but the centers look slightly soft.
  8. C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ack.

Notes

For extra chewiness, consider adding more sweetener or refrigerating the dough before baking.
